picture In 1975 (Czechoslovakia), this 12,000-ton Gothic church was moved 841 meters on rails to save it from a coal mine that swallowed the rest of the city. It took 28 days, moving at just 2cm per minute, and still holds the Guinness World Record for the heaviest building ever moved on a rail system.
